Mercurial > repos > dfornika > snippy
comparison snippy_core_wrapper.py @ 12:a2f07b210776 draft
planemo upload for repository https://github.com/tseemann/snippy commit 93b22331ca83a82fdfbe8f2b274577e21f9bf025-dirty
author | dfornika |
---|---|
date | Mon, 21 Jan 2019 19:48:23 -0500 |
parents | 502763099477 |
children | c92d935dc8ab |
comparison
equal
deleted
inserted
replaced
11:502763099477 | 12:a2f07b210776 |
---|---|
27 | 27 |
28 snippy_core_command_line = ['snippy-core', '--ref', args.ref] | 28 snippy_core_command_line = ['snippy-core', '--ref', args.ref] |
29 | 29 |
30 for indir in args.indirs.split(','): | 30 for indir in args.indirs.split(','): |
31 base_name = os.path.basename(indir) | 31 base_name = os.path.basename(indir) |
32 sys.stderr.write(indir + '\n') | |
33 copyfile(indir, base_name) | 32 copyfile(indir, base_name) |
34 sys.stderr.write('\n'.join([indir, base_name]) + '\n') | |
35 subprocess.Popen(['tar', '-xf', base_name]) | 33 subprocess.Popen(['tar', '-xf', base_name]) |
36 | 34 |
37 extracted_dirs = [f.path for f in os.listdir('.') if f.is_dir() ] | 35 extracted_dirs = [f.path for f in os.listdir('.') if os.path.isdir(f) ] |
38 | 36 |
39 for extracted_dir in extracted_dirs: | 37 for extracted_dir in extracted_dirs: |
40 snippy_core_command_line.append(extracted_dir) | 38 snippy_core_command_line.append(extracted_dir) |
41 | 39 |
42 print(snippy_core_command_line) | |
43 subprocess.Popen(snippy_core_command_line) | 40 subprocess.Popen(snippy_core_command_line) |
44 | 41 |
45 if __name__ == '__main__': | 42 if __name__ == '__main__': |
46 main() | 43 main() |